    hud·dle
    [ˈhəd(ə)l]
    verb
    huddle (verb) · huddles (third person present) · huddled (past tense) · huddled (past participle) · huddling (present participle)
    1. crowd together; nestle closely:
      "they huddled together for warmth"
      • curl one's body into a small space:
        "the watchman remained, huddled under his canvas shelter"
      • NORTH AMERICAN ENGLISH
        draw together for an informal, private conversation:
        "selection committee members huddled with attorneys"
      • BRITISH ENGLISH
        heap together in a disorderly manner:
        "a man with his clothes all huddled on anyhow"
    noun
    huddle (noun) · huddles (plural noun)
    1. a crowded or confused mass of people or things:
      "a huddle of barns and outbuildings"
      • a small group of people holding an informal, private conversation:
        "they stood together in a huddle, whispering to each other"
      • a brief gathering of players during a game to receive instructions, especially in football:
        "he controls the huddle and the team better than anybody else"
      • archaic
        confusion; bustle:
        "the service was performed with more harmony and less huddle than I have known it"
    Origin
    late 16th century (in the sense ‘conceal’): perhaps of Low German origin.
